Vine pruning is a important practice for maintaining healthy development, managing size, and improving fruit or flower production. Regular pruning gets rid of dead, damaged, or overcrowded stems, which improves air flow, light penetration, and reduces the danger of illness. Proper timing and technique depend on the type of vine, its development habit, and the preferred result, whether for ornamental functions or fruit production. Techniques such as heading cuts, thinning cuts, and training along trellises or supports guide the plant's growth and improve structural strength. Pruning likewise motivates vigorous brand-new shoots and blooming, while keeping vines from becoming invasive or overgrown. A constant pruning schedule promotes long-term health and visual appeal, guaranteeing vines stay appealing and productive. Proper vine management adds to total landscape looks and boosts the functionality of garden features such as arbors, pergolas, and fences
